The sparsely populated towns of the Wicklow coast seem a world away from jet-setting Dublin, although the allure of the capital draws commuters from as far away as Wicklow Town. The area lacks the heavy-hitting historical hot spots of the inland route through Glendalough and Kilkenny but provides kilometers of untouristed, sheep-filled fields that wind over cliffs and dunes to the sparkling sea. Hikers and cyclists can find plenty of fantastic routes to enjoy.
